Would it be out-of-place for me to recommend selectrum as a
replacement? On the GitHub (https://github.com/raxod502/selectrum) it
advertises to not break any of the existing abstractions, something
which they claim both Ivy and Helm are terrible at.
The biggest road-block I can see is that its MIT licensed but if they
were willing to re-license it, the project only has 9 contributors,
all of which seem quite active.
